#include "tlSystemPaths.h"
#include "tlString.h"
#include <QDir>
#include <QCoreApplication>
#ifdef _WIN32
# include <windows.h>
#endif
#include <cstdlib>
namespace tl
{
std::string
get_appdata_path ()
{
QDir appdata_dir = QDir::homePath ();
QString appdata_folder;
#ifdef _WIN32
appdata_folder = QString::fromUtf8 ("KLayout");
#else
appdata_folder = QString::fromUtf8 (".klayout");
#endif
// create the basic folder hierarchy
if (! appdata_dir.exists (appdata_folder)) {
appdata_dir.mkdir (appdata_folder);
}
QString appdata_klayout_path = appdata_dir.absoluteFilePath (appdata_folder);
QDir appdata_klayout_dir (appdata_klayout_path);
const char *folders[] = { "macros", "drc", "libraries", "tech" };
for (size_t i = 0; i < sizeof (folders) / sizeof (folders [0]); ++i) {
QString folder = QString::fromUtf8 (folders [i]);
if (! appdata_klayout_dir.exists (folder)) {
appdata_klayout_dir.mkdir (folder);
}
}
return tl::to_string (appdata_klayout_path);
}
std::string
get_inst_path ()
{
return tl::to_string (QCoreApplication::applicationDirPath ());
}
#ifdef _WIN32
static void
get_other_system_paths (std::vector <std::string> &p)
{
// Use "Application Data" if it exists on Windows
const wchar_t *appdata_env = 0;
if ((appdata_env = _wgetenv (L"APPDATA")) != 0) {
QDir appdata_dir = QString ((const QChar *) appdata_env);
QString appdata_folder = QString::fromUtf8 ("KLayout");
if (appdata_dir.exists () && appdata_dir.exists (appdata_folder)) {
p.push_back (tl::to_string (appdata_dir.absoluteFilePath (appdata_folder)));
}
}
}
#else
static void
get_other_system_paths (std::vector <std::string> &)
{
// .. nothing yet ..
}
#endif
static void
split_path (const std::string &path, std::vector <std::string> &pc)
{
QString sep;
#ifdef _WIN32
sep = QString::fromUtf8 (";");
#else
sep = QString::fromUtf8 (":");
#endif
QStringList pp = tl::to_qstring (path).split (sep, QString::SkipEmptyParts);
for (QStringList::ConstIterator p = pp.begin (); p != pp.end (); ++p) {
pc.push_back (tl::to_string (*p));
}
}
std::vector<std::string>
get_klayout_path ()
{
std::vector<std::string> klayout_path;
// generate the klayout path: the first component is always the appdata path
klayout_path.push_back (get_appdata_path ());
#ifdef _WIN32
wchar_t *env = _wgetenv (L"KLAYOUT_PATH");
if (env) {
split_path (tl::to_string (QString ((const QChar *) env)), klayout_path);
} else {
get_other_system_paths (klayout_path);
klayout_path.push_back (get_inst_path ());
}
#else
char *env = getenv ("KLAYOUT_PATH");
if (env) {
split_path (tl::system_to_string (env), klayout_path);
} else {
get_other_system_paths (klayout_path);
klayout_path.push_back (get_inst_path ());
}
#endif
return klayout_path;
}
}
